logo

Output 121a51f15f7239dd3fc84af24a983a3e21ccd448f6bc5b0758e79ef108c62f82:0

value
250000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57b0c2aa078969f6747950a766b32f601871af19 OP_EQUAL
address
39ggTm7YtbUXEx6eiaDypu3mqmB3S7Smbd
transaction
121a51f15f7239dd3fc84af24a983a3e21ccd448f6bc5b0758e79ef108c62f82